Types of Wells

Wells are constructed differently depending on various factors like location, water demand, and the underlying geological structure. Here are some common types of wells:

  • Dug or Bored Wells: These are large holes dug manually with a shovel or with machinery and are usually shallow, less than 30 feet deep.
  • Driven Wells: Made by driving a pipe into the ground, these wells are typically from 30 to 50 feet deep.
  • Drilled Wells: Commonly used, these wells can reach depths of thousands of feet, constructed using rotaries or percussion drilling.

Understanding which type of well you have can help you assess the risks and take appropriate precautions to safeguard your water.

Groundwater: Your Well’s Source

Groundwater is found in aquifers—layers of rock and soil that store water. It moves slowly through pore spaces and cracks in rock beneath the surface. The quality of your well water can be influenced by various factors, including geological formations and human activity above ground. Animal Contributions to Water Contamination

While animals play a natural part in the ecosystem, their presence can pose risks to your well. Let’s explore how animals might contribute to water contamination.

Animal Feces and Contamination

Animals, both wild and domestic, can contaminate well water through their feces. When animals defecate, harmful bacteria, viruses, and parasites can make their way into the soil and eventually the water table. Here’s a closer look at what this contamination entails:

  • Bacteria: Pathogens like E. coli, Salmonella, and Campylobacter can enter your water, causing illnesses.
  • Viruses: Hepatitis A and Norovirus can seep into groundwater from animal waste.
  • Parasites: Giardia and Cryptosporidium are parasites that might find their way into your well through fecal contamination.

Direct Animal Access

Animals can directly access wells if proper barriers aren’t in place. This access isn’t limited to small creatures; larger animals can also impact your water supply:

  • Wildlife: Raccoons, birds, and rodents can find their way into wells, especially if covers are inadequate.
  • Domestic Animals: Livestock, like cattle and sheep, can trample over or contaminate wells if they graze too closely.

The presence of animals around wellheads increases the risk of contamination. Maintaining physical barriers is key to preventing direct animal entry.

How Animals Reach Your Well

You might be wondering how animals actually reach your well in the first place. Well, there are several pathways that can lead to contamination.

Surface Water Runoff

Runoff from rain or melting snow can carry animal waste into your well. When water travels quickly over land, it can pick up contaminants on its journey to lower ground. Factors that increase this risk include:

  • Sloped Terrain: Water moving downhill can carry away contaminants with ease.
  • Proximity: Wells located near areas with dense animal populations, like farms, are at greater risk.

Soil Permeability

Soil plays a vital role in filtering contaminants, but not all soil is created equal. The permeability of the soil around your well affects how easily contaminants break through to groundwater:

  • Porous Soils: Sandy or gravelly soil allows water—and contaminants—to permeate quickly.
  • Less Permeable Soil: Clay-heavy soils tend to slow down the movement of water, providing more time for natural filtration.

Being aware of your soil type can help you understand the potential for contamination and guide you in adopting preventive measures.

Cracks and Openings

Structural issues with your well can provide easy access for contaminants:

  • Damaged Casings: Fissures or rust in well casings can provide a path for bacteria and debris.
  • Openings or Gaps: Loose well covers or caps can invite smaller creatures and debris into your well.

Regular inspections can help you identify and address these vulnerabilities before they lead to contamination issues.

Preventive Measures to Protect Your Well

Now that you have an understanding of how animals can contaminate your well, let’s focus on steps you can take to protect your water supply. Implementing these practical measures can help ensure the safety and quality of your water.

Secure Structural Integrity

Ensuring your well is structurally sound is the first line of defense against contamination. Here’s what you can do:

  • Regular Inspections: Perform routine checks of well integrity, looking for any cracks or damage.
  • Secure Covers: Make sure all openings are covered with secure, animal-proof lids.
  • Elevate the Wellhead: Raise wellheads above the ground level to prevent surface water from entering.

Implement Proper Landscaping

Landscaping plays a crucial role in directing water flow and preventing contamination from surface runoff. Consider these tips:

  • Buffer Zones: Create buffer zones by planting grass or vegetation around your well to help absorb and filter runoff.
  • Redirect Runoff: Use swales or berms to redirect water away from your well, minimizing the risk of contaminants reaching it.

Manage Animal Access

Limiting animal access to the area surrounding your well is essential in reducing contamination risks. Here’s how:

  • Fencing: Install fencing around the perimeter of the well to deter livestock and larger wildlife.
  • Animal Management: Keep domestic animals in defined areas away from the well, ensuring safe distances are maintained.

Testing Your Well Water

Regular testing of your well water is crucial to detect any contamination early. It ensures that your water remains safe for consumption. Let’s delve into the testing process and what it entails.

When to Test

The frequency and timing of well water testing can vary, but general guidelines include:

  • Annually: Test at least once a year for bacteria and nitrates.
  • Changes in Taste or Smell: Immediately test if you notice a change in water taste, smell, or appearance.
  • After Flooding or Heavy Rainfall: Test promptly after environmental events that might increase contamination risks.

What to Test For

Different contaminants warrant specific tests. Here are common parameters:

Contaminant TypeReason for Testing
BacteriaDetect pathogens like E. coli
NitratesHigh levels can cause health issues
pH LevelsIndicate water acidity or alkalinity
ChemicalsIdentify pollutants from agricultural run-off or industrial activities

How to Test

Testing your well water can be done in a few ways:

  • Professional Testing: Engage certified laboratories for comprehensive reports.
  • DIY Kits: Use at-home test kits for quick and preliminary results.

Remember, professional testing provides the most reliable and accurate information for evaluating water safety.

Responding to Contamination

Finding out your well is contaminated can be alarming, but understanding how to respond effectively can remedy the situation. Let’s outline the steps you need to take.

Immediate Actions

If contamination is detected, take immediate actions to reduce risk:

  • Boil Water: Boil water before using it for drinking or cooking to kill pathogens.
  • Use Bottled Water: Temporarily switch to bottled water for consumption until issues are resolved.

Resolve the Source

Identify and eliminate the contamination source:

  • Well Disinfection: Use shock chlorination to disinfect the well.
  • Repair Structural Issues: Fix cracks or seal gaps that allow contaminants in.

Long-Term Solutions

Implement long-term measures to prevent future contamination:

  • Regular Maintenance and Monitoring: Continue routine checks and testing to catch potential issues.
  • Upgrade Systems: Consider installing water treatment systems for additional filtration and purification.
